First, remember the Roam (including the Move) is designed as a portable speaker unlike other Sonos that are meant t one stationary. However….

In settings for your Roam’s under Room you can select a pre-set name or type your own. For example:

White Roams

  • White 1 Living / White 2 Living. As a Stereo Pair the distinct naming would be lost

Black Roams

  • Black 1 Den / Black 2 Den. As a Stereo Pair the distinct naming would be lost

However, that only makes sense if you intend to leave them in the room on your your network. As soon as you switch to BlueTooth and/or move out of range of your network the stereo pair is broken. You could sticky dot label one speaker as left and the other without the sticky dot would of course be right. Here again...as soon as you switch to BlueTooth and/or move out of range of your network the stereo pair is broken.

Until Sonos figures out away to make the stereo pair auto-rejoin your efforts are probably for naught :thinking:
